This second generation of High-Speed Data Services Solution, Technicolor keeps up to eight (8) bonded downstream channels and four (4) bonded upstream channels, with a design backward-compatible for use as a single-channel with older networks without any service interruption.

2.31 Firmware
The DCM476 model we received contained the 2.31 firmware and not the newer 2.5 firmware. From what I understand the newer firmware improves channel bonding and fixes other issues. Just FYI to potential buyers.

I purchased the modem in early January to use with TekSavvy Internet service. I just recently switched to TekSavvy from Rogers on February 5th. The transition was quite simple. I had to provide TekSavvy with the MAC address of this modem in advance and on the day of the switch, I just had to swap the modems.Everything appears to be working great. I am noticing some errors in the modem logs, however, it does not appear to be causing any disconnect issues so that's good.
